> In file included from ../../../../gcc-6.3.0/libgcc/unwind-dw2.c:401:0:
> ./md-unwind-support.h: In function 'x86_fallback_frame_state':
> ./md-unwind-support.h:141:18: error: field 'uc' has incomplete type
>   struct ucontext uc;
>                   ^~
> make[5]: *** [../../../../gcc-6.3.0/libgcc/shared-object.mk:14:

This GCC code was actually not following the relevant standards and
was broken by a change in glibc when glibc got stricter.

You can fix it by replacing "struct ucontext" with "ucontext_t" in the
relevant files.
